The Red Spear Society staged a major uprising in 1928–1929 against the rule of Liu Zhennian, the Nationalist government-aligned warlord ruler of eastern Shandong province in Republican China. Motivated by their resistance against high taxes, rampant banditry and the brutality of Liu's private army, the Red Spear peasant insurgents captured large areas on the Shandong Peninsula and were able to set up a proto-state in Dengzhou county. Despite this, the whole insurgency was eventually crushed by Liu in late 1929.
